Pathway clearing services involve removing obstacles, debris, overgrown vegetation, and other obstructions from walkways, driveways, and pathways around residential properties. This work ensures that outdoor areas are safe, accessible, and visually appealing. Professionals typically use specialized tools and equipment to clear away fallen branches, overgrown bushes, and accumulated dirt or debris that can make pathways difficult to navigate. Regular clearing not only improves the appearance of a property but also helps prevent accidents caused by tripping hazards or slippery surfaces.
Many property owners turn to pathway clearing services when they notice their walkways becoming obstructed or unsafe. Common problems include overgrown plants blocking access, fallen leaves and branches creating slippery surfaces, or dirt and mud accumulating after storms. These issues can make it difficult to use outdoor spaces comfortably and safely, especially for children, elderly residents, or visitors. Clearing pathways regularly helps maintain a clean, safe environment and can prevent more costly repairs or extensive cleanup in the future.

The overview below groups typical Pathway Clearing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Conyers, GA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or clearing jobs such as removing small debris or overgrown vegetation usually range from $250 to $600. Many routine projects fall within this middle range, depending on the size and scope.
Medium-Scale Projects - Clearing larger areas or more dense vegetation can c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common for property maintenance and often involve more extensive work by local contractors.
Large or Complex Jobs - Larger, more complex clearing projects, such as extensive land clearing or removal of large trees, can reach $1,500 to $5,000 or more. These tend to be less frequent but are necessary for significant property renovations or development.
Full Property Clearing - Complete clearing services for entire properties typically start around $3,000 and can exceed $10,000 for very large or heavily overgrown sites. Many service providers offer customized quotes based on the specific land and scope of work.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
